A 24-year-old woman, gravida 1 para 0, at 35 weeks gestation comes to the office for a routine prenatal visit. The patient has dichorionic diamniotic twins and has had no complications during the pregnancy. Fetal movement is normal for each twin. Over the past week, the patient developed a pruritic rash on the abdomen. The pruritus has become progressively more severe and is preventing her from sleeping. She has no chronic medical conditions. Vital signs are normal. The fetal heart rate for both twins is 150/min. Fundal height is 38 cm. Physical examination is seen in the exhibit.
No other lesions are visualized. Which of the following is the most appropriate treatment for this patient?
A) Oral antibiotics
B) Oral antiviral therapy
C) Topical corticosteroids
D) Topical retinoids
E) Ursodeoxycholic acid
